Every year people move to the Asheville area by the tens of thousands. Asheville, NC, is a popular destination for new residents due to several factors:

  • Scenic Beauty: The city is renowned for its breathtaking mountain landscapes, making it a favorite among nature lovers.
  • Cultural Offerings: Asheville has a vibrant arts community featuring numerous galleries, theaters, and street performances in its downtown area.
  • Culinary and Brewing Scene: Asheville boasts a growing food culture and is widely recognized for its numerous craft beer breweries.
  • Robust Economy: The city’s economy is expanding, with a diverse mix of technology, healthcare, and tourism industries.
  • High Quality of Life: Asheville consistently ranks high as a place to live, offering a low cost of living, welcoming communities, and a comfortable climate.
  • Accessibility: Asheville is within a reasonable driving distance from several major cities, including Charlotte, Atlanta, and Greenville.

Asheville’s growth and popularity have increased the need for living space, making rental property ownership a potentially lucrative option for those looking to diversify their portfolio. A growing population and robust local economy have resulted in a constant influx of renters searching for reasonably priced, well-maintained residences.

How to Improve Your Rental Property’s ROI in Asheville

Return on investment (ROI) can be improved in rental properties in several ways:

  1. Increasing the rent regularly by market trends can increase the return on investment of a rental property.
  2. Updating a rental property’s appliances, fixtures, and finishes can increase its value and appeal to tenants, increasing rental income and return on investment.
  3. Reducing operating costs, such as property management fees, maintenance, and utility bills, can increase a rental property’s net income and return on investment.
  4. Maximize rental income and return on investment by keeping the property occupied with responsible tenants.
  5. Diversify your portfolio by purchasing multiple rental properties to lower your risk and increase your return on investment.
  6. Tax deductions and credits can reduce taxable income and improve return on investment. These credits and deductions include depreciation, mortgage interest, property taxes, and maintenance costs.
  7. To improve productivity, cut costs, and increase return on investment, install smart home technology like keyless entry systems, energy-efficient appliances, and remote property management tools.

Use a Property Management Company to Improve ROI

Property management companies help you improve ROI by:

  • A reliable property management firm can help you fill your units faster with high-quality renters. 
  • A property management company can handle the accounting and rent collection for the landlord, freeing them up to focus on other matters.
  • When it comes to repairs and maintenance, property management companies have the manpower and tools to handle these tasks regularly, which saves money and time for landlords and tenants alike.
  • Property management firms keep up with ever-changing local, state, and federal rental laws and regulations, protecting property owners from potential fines and lawsuits.
  • Property management firms can improve occupancy rates by keeping rental properties in good shape, advertising them extensively, and setting reasonable rents, all of which boost a building’s return on investment.
